Public bug reported:
For the past few weeks I've been unable to install the Lucid beta on my
desktop machine; update-manager always said it was unable to "calculate
the upgrade."
Some bug-reporting work on other upgrade problems led me to the logs in
/var/log/dist-upgrade, which contained much more useful information. It
turn out that I can get the upgrade going by un-installing software-
center (and ubuntu-desktop, which depends on it—I'm sure I'll be able to
restore that later).
